Integrating with Typography and Design Systems
A background's effectiveness is often judged by how well it supports its foreground elements, especially typography. The structured nature of these light pink abstract backgrounds makes them exceptionally compatible with a range of typefaces. They pair beautifully with clean sans serif fonts for a fully modern, tech-forward look. When combined with a elegant serif font, the contrast can produce a sophisticated, editorial feel—imagine a luxury lifestyle magazine's layout. For projects needing a personal touch, a tasteful script font or handwritten font can sit atop these backgrounds, the geometric shapes providing a stabilizing frame that enhances legibility.
From a usability perspective, the lightness of the pink ensures that text set in dark colors—black, charcoal, navy—maintains excellent contrast and readability. This is a non-negotiable requirement for any professional publishing or web design project. The backgrounds influence the overall visual hierarchy by adding depth and dimension without competing for dominance. They can guide a viewer's eye in a specific direction based on the flow of the geometric shapes, a subtle but powerful tool for content creators and marketers designing infographics or presentation slides.
Practical Guidance for Selection and Use
When choosing from the ten included papers, consider the emotional tone of your project. Some patterns may be more active with intersecting lines and bold polygons, ideal for energetic marketing campaigns or creative agency portfolios. Others may feature softer gradients and faded shapes, better suited for wellness, beauty, or baby product branding where calm is key. Always test a font pairing on your chosen background. Place sample text over it to check for readability at various sizes, especially for smaller body copy or mobile views.
